NBC News
The White House informed Congress of its plans to cut $4.9 billion in foreign aid funding through a seldom-used budgetary tactic dubbed “pocket rescissions,” two congressional sources tell NBC News. https://www.nbcnews.com/politics/white-house/trump-pocket-rescissions-slash-foreign-aid-congress-rcna227973?cid=sm_npd_nn_tw_ma&taid=68b1e5f565047c0001bb3d0c&utm_campaign=trueanthem&utm_medium=social&utm_source=twitter
